Goal Statement
The goal of this activity is to improve healthcare professionals’ competence in appropriately individualizing the choice of ART regimens in diverse clinical scenarios.

Target Audience
This activity is intended for physicians, pharmacists, registered nurses, and other healthcare professionals who provide care for people living with HIV.

Learning Objectives
Upon completion of this event, participants should be able to:

  • Select an appropriately individualized ART regimen for each person living with HIV when initiating therapy or modifying a virologically suppressive regimen
  • Apply best practices in the individualized management of comorbidities and comedications that occur commonly among people living with HIV
  • Identify how anticipated future ART agents may provide additional options for selecting a regimen that is optimized for each individual
